One of my favourite cafes around Crows Nest and St Leonards! It’s the main place I keep on going back and back for lunch at. My most frequent pick is the pulled pork sandwich, with either fries or salad on the side. The fries are the extra thin ones, that I’m not always a fan of, but they go just right with the sandwiches. Alternatively, check out the specials listed on the wall, of which there’s usually a large number. I’ve had a few different salads, and they’ve all been excellent — fresh, a wide variety of ingredients, and filling enough for lunch. The juices are also great. If you haven’t made a booking for lunch, head here on the early side, as it fills up quickly(especially as the longer tables often have group bookings from the surrounding businesses). DOGTIP: There’s a few table just outside, with dogs welcome and a bowl of water provided.
